日韩无码专区无码一级三级片|91人人爱网站中日韩无码电影|厨房大战丰满熟妇|AV高清无码在线免费观看|另类AV日韩少妇熟女|中文日本大黄一级黄色片|色情在线视频免费|亚洲成人特黄a片|黄片wwwav色图欧美|欧亚乱色一区二区三区

RELATEED CONSULTING
相關(guān)咨詢
選擇下列產(chǎn)品馬上在線溝通
服務(wù)時間:8:30-17:00
你可能遇到了下面的問題
關(guān)閉右側(cè)工具欄

新聞中心

這里有您想知道的互聯(lián)網(wǎng)營銷解決方案
Cocos2D實現(xiàn)Fruit Ninja里面刀光效果教程

Cocos2D實現(xiàn)Fruit Ninja里面刀光效果教是本文要介紹的內(nèi)容,詳細(xì)的介紹了Cocos2D游戲開發(fā)里面的一個效果,先來看詳細(xì)內(nèi)容介紹。

創(chuàng)新互聯(lián)專注于孝義企業(yè)網(wǎng)站建設(shè),成都響應(yīng)式網(wǎng)站建設(shè),商城網(wǎng)站定制開發(fā)。孝義網(wǎng)站建設(shè)公司,為孝義等地區(qū)提供建站服務(wù)。全流程定制網(wǎng)站設(shè)計,專業(yè)設(shè)計,全程項目跟蹤,創(chuàng)新互聯(lián)專業(yè)和態(tài)度為您提供的服務(wù)

實現(xiàn)思路:

√ 從多點觸摸得到劃過的軌跡,控制點數(shù)量,一般使用隊列,新的點擠出隊尾的點. 這里表示為point[16];

√ 循環(huán);  point和point[i+1]構(gòu)成直線l, 計算直線的斜率, 從斜率得到夾角θ(可以溫習(xí)極坐標(biāo)),從而得到l的法線方程(Xcosθ+ysinθ-p=0);
以寬度W(-W),沿著法線方向平移point, 得到2條平移的軌跡.
這里的W的絕對值,頭部應(yīng)該寬些,尾部收縮到0.

關(guān)鍵算法:

 
 
 
 
  1.      
  2. CGPoint pt = ccpSub(p1, p2);    
  3. GLfloat angle = ccpToAngle(pt);         
  4. GLfloat x = sinf(angle) * w;    
  5. GLfloat y = cosf(angle) * w;    
  6. vertex->x = p1.x+x;    
  7. vertex->y = p1.y-y;    
  8.    

源碼下載:http://www.cocoachina.com/bbs/job.php?action=download&aid=17941
 
小結(jié):Cocos2D實現(xiàn)Fruit Ninja里面刀光效果教程的內(nèi)容介紹完了,希望通過本文的學(xué)習(xí)能對你有所幫助!


本文名稱:Cocos2D實現(xiàn)Fruit Ninja里面刀光效果教程
網(wǎng)站URL:http://m.5511xx.com/article/cohejci.html